This course helped me see Pinterest as more than just a place to collect ideas. It can be a meaningful tool in the classroom. Before this course, I had not used Pinterest with students, but now I have a better understanding of how it can support learning. I learned that Pinterest helps students build thinking skills like recognizing important details, sorting information, and reflecting on what they learn. These skills are part of the cognitive structures we studied, and they really help students make sense of what they’re learning. The most valuable lesson for me was about giving students more control. When they organize and label content in their own way, it helps them think more deeply. I want to bring more of this into my teaching, especially when we focus on reading and writing skills like character analysis or theme. My favorite assignment was designing a lesson plan that uses Pinterest. It helped me connect everything from the course and gave me something I can really use with my students next year.

This class was disguised as a course about how to develop a professional learning network via Pinterest and how to use the app in an educational setting. The first few assignments certainly helped me gain the PLN portion of the description, but the rest of the class was completely off track. There were two books initially needed for this course. After I had purchased the books and it was too late to return them, I was emailed by the instructor informing me that they had changed the syllabus and that I now only needed one of the books. The book used for this course is about cognitive development and from 2007. The education world has changed quite a bit since then! The connections the instructors tried to make to Pinterest are an extreme stretch and not very practical. This course may be good for a beginning teacher who isn’t really interested in learning about Pinterest and how to connect it with their classroom, but rather how to help their students build their cognitive structure.

If you want to know the direction of education, take this class. It is a great start to creating your PLN: personal learning network. Warning: This is not a pinning class, but a class of how to help you and your students pin ideas. Be prepared to work: lots of reading, written responses, three lesson plans, and don't buy the book on Kindle unless you have a 3rd generation or higher (you will need actual page to site sources for your final paper).
